David Carr serves as the Executive Vice President and Managing Director, EMEA, responsible for Align Technology’s market development and operational execution of all Align Technology products and services in the EMEA region. Mr. Carr joined the company in September 2024 originally as the Executive Vice President and Managing Director, APAC. With over 25 years of management experience in healthcare and the automotive industry, Mr. Carr has established an impressive record of delivering results in the most competitive and dynamic markets across the globe. He started his career as an engineer in Japan and has spent over twenty years in med tech leadership roles with GE Healthcare and Medtronic, located in Asia, Europe, the Middle East & Africa, and the United States. Mr. Carr holds an MBA and a Bachelor of Mechanical Engineering from University College Dublin, Ireland.
Julie Coletti is Executive Vice President, Chief Legal and Regulatory Officer of Align Technology, where she leads Align’s world-class legal, regulatory, and quality teams and serves as corporate secretary to the Align Technology Inc.’s Board of Directors. Ms. Coletti joined the company in May 2018 as Vice President, Associate General Counsel, Strategic Commercial Affairs before her promotion to her current position in May 2019. Prior to joining Align, she served as Vice President and Global General Counsel of Danaher Corporation’s $3 billion dental medical device platform and Vice President, Chief Legal Officer at Bayer HealthCare's MEDRAD/Radiology and Interventional Division, a manufacturer of pharmaceuticals and medical devices for imaging and interventional cardiology. She began her career in litigation at LeBoeuf, Lamb, Greene & MacRae LLP before joining Bayer Corporation’s in-house litigation team.

Dr. Mitra Derakhshan is currently Executive Vice President, Chief Clinical Officer,Global Treatment Planning and Clinical Services at Align Technology, responsible for the global clinical teams, including global treatment planning and clinical services. She has held numerous prior roles at Align Technology since August 2000 spanning across clinical in the areas of manufacturing, R&D, international, and global marketing. She is instrumental in many key initiatives, such as product innovation, education programs, portfolio and software development, case galleries, and research studies. Dr. Derakhshan also practices orthodontics as an associate in private practice. She has lectured worldwide on Invisalign clear aligners. Dr. Derakhshan has published in the Journal of Clinical Orthodontics, Seminars in Orthodontics, World Journal of Orthodontics; and authored many of Align Technology's continuing education materials and holds multiple patents. She is a member of the AAO, ADA, and FRCD (C). Dr. Derakhshan received her Doctor of Dental Surgery (DDS) at the University of Michigan and her Master of Science (MS) and Certificate in Orthodontics at the University of Illinois at Chicago.
JunHo Han serves as the Executive Vice President and Managing Director of the Asia Pacific region. He has responsibility for market development and operational execution of all Align Technology products and services in the APAC region. Mr. Han joined Align in January 2019 and has held senior leadership roles of increasing responsibility across China, North Asia, and the Asia Pacific region. Since joining the company, he has served as Vice President and Managing Director for China and North Asia, and has led Asia Pacific commercial operations, customer experience and sales enablement. Prior to joining Align, Mr. Han held senior leadership positions at Edwards Lifesciences and Johnson & Johnson, where he built high-performing organizations, advanced market access, and delivered strong growth across North Asia and Asia Pacific markets. Mr. Han holds an MBA from Sogang University Graduate School of Business in Korea and a Bachelor’s degree in Public Administration from Hankuk University of Foreign Studies.
Srini Kaza serves as Executive Vice President, Research & Development, responsible for leading the global product R&D group. He joined the company in April 1999, most recently serving as Senior Vice President, Product Research & Development, with focus areas such as Biomechanics, Advanced Materials, 3D Printing, 3D Computational Geometry, AI, Clinical Affairs, Advanced Simulation and Design, and emerging technologies and processes.
Mr. Kaza has made significant contributions over the years in developing several 3D printing technologies, scanning processes, innovative materials, 3D software and several other technologies during his tenure at Align.
Under his supervision, the R&D group has created several new products and underlying technologies that enable Invisalign product performance improvements. His team has most recently developed the Invisalign Palatal Expander product. In addition, his team created the patented SmartTrack® material, specially engineered for the Invisalign system, and continues to work on future advancements. His team also conducts multiple clinical studies that aim to create better understanding of Invisalign product performance and manages the University Research Programs, intended to create close collaborations with universities worldwide to help advance the science in the dental field. Mr. Kaza holds an M.S. degree in Mechanical Engineering from the University of Utah and an M.B.A. degree from the Wharton School of Business.
Sreelakshmi Kolli is Executive Vice President, Chief Product and Digital Officer, responsible for our product lifecycle, from product ideation and innovation, to engineering, product launch and product performance. This includes leading the product and engineering teams and defining the technology strategy and development of product software, consumer, customer, manufacturing and enterprise applications enabling the Align Digital Platform. Ms. Kolli has led Align’s global business transformation initiative aimed at delivering platforms and technology to support customer experience and simplified business processes across the company. She joined the company in June 2003 and has held positions of increasing responsibility, leading and transforming business operations and engineering teams and platforms. Prior to joining Align, Ms. Kolli held technical lead positions with Citadon and Accenture. She is a member of the Board of Directors at Intuitive (Nasdaq: ISRG) and Zimmer Biomet Holdings, Inc. (NYSE:ZBH). Ms. Kolli earned an M.S. degree in Computer Applications at the National Institute of Technology in Trichy, India and is a graduate of the Stanford Executive Program offered by the Stanford Graduate School of Business in California.
Frank Quinn serves as the Executive Vice President and Managing Director of the Americas region. He has responsibility for market development and operational execution of all Align Technology products and services in the Americas region. Mr. Quinn re-joined Align in October 2024 after spending two years at LightForce Orthodontics, where he served as Chief Revenue Officer. Prior to his role at LightForce, Mr. Quinn spent nearly 9 years at Align serving in multiple roles including Vice President and General Manager, where he was responsible for driving continued growth and profitability for the United States. During his time at Align, Mr. Quinn’s other positions included Senior Sales Director of Special Markets and iTero, Vice President of Special Markets, Business Development and Education. Mr. Quinn has a wealth of experience driving growth, strategy and revenue in the orthodontics industry. As a successful executive leader across the medical and technology industries, he combines strong sales leadership experience with expertise in business development, innovation, professional education, commercial operations and culture building. Mr. Quinn has also served as a Board Member of the American Association of Orthodontics Foundation (AAOF) and the American Academy of Clear Aligners (AACA). He holds a BS in Business Administration and Marketing from Montclair State University.
